Exploring Software: An Introduction to its Inner Workings

Software, the invisible force driving our digital world, often feels like a mystery. But grasping its inner workings doesn't require a qualification in computer science. At its core, software is a set of commands that tell a computer what to do. These instructions are written in languages that humans can understand, and they form the basis of everything from simple calculators to complex applications.

  • By breaking down software into its fundamental parts, we can obtain a clearer perspective of how it functions.
  • Procedures form the heart of software, providing step-by-step solutions to specific challenges
  • Data, the raw material that software processes, is organized in various types.

Demystifying software empowers us to engage with technology more effectively. It allows us to appreciate the intricacy behind our digital experiences and opens doors to building our own software solutions.
